Free parenting classes are offered at many local schools and colleges. Social services in your area have a list of free parenting classes that are usually at night for parents who work during the day. Also daycare providers can often have classes after working hours for parents who are looking for great information about parenting.

Balancing work and parenting can be challenging, but it is important to establish clear boundaries and prioritize tasks. Effective time management, setting realistic expectations, and seeking support from family and childcare resources can help maintain productivity at work while ensuring quality time with your child. Open communication with your employer about your parenting responsibilities can also lead to a more flexible and accommodating work schedule.

The concept of parenting styles was developed by psychologist Diana Baumrind in the early 1960s. She identified three primary styles—authoritative, authoritarian, and permissive—based on her research on parent-child interactions. Later, a fourth style, neglectful or uninvolved parenting, was added by researchers. Baumrind's work has significantly influenced understanding of parenting and child development.
